Tuesday update: Doodles is taking a few steps in her own! The staff likened her to a baby giraffe leaning to walk, vet said she's still a bit ataxic. I couldn't visit her today because I had to work. She is coming home Thursday! Urethral catheter has been removed, she's starting to eat again and they feel her stubbornness is a good sign. I knew her stubbornness was a very good sign. The neurologist is really happy with her progress. Bought her a Help'em Up Harness today, an having it overnighted and I should have it tomorrow.

I bought runners at Bed Bath & Beyond for Sir Elton which gave him the stability he needed. Actually 5 x 7 rugs can be bought for under $100 on sale. We put one in the entryway for him as well. Our current boy doesn't like tile so these work for him as well.
